Portage, MI dialysis technician salary overview (2026 est., based on 2025 BLS)

In 2026, dialysis technicians in Portage, Michigan, are projected to earn a median annual salary of $41,763, which is approximately 7.85% lower than the national median salary of $45,322 for this role. The overall salary range for technicians in the area spans from $32,844 at the low end (10th percentile) to $64,732 for those at the high end (90th percentile), reflecting the variability based on experience and specific job responsibilities. These figures are derived from 2025 BLS state-level data estimates and adjusted for regional cost factors, providing a distinct perspective on local compensation. Job seekers in this market must also be aware of available shift differentials, particularly early-morning chair turnover premiums that can enhance earnings for those who are flexible with their hours, as employment with prominent providers like Fresenius and DaVita dominates the local market.

Dialysis Technician Job Market in Portage

Currently, the job market in Portage employs around 7 dialysis technicians, contributing to a competitive yet cautious landscape. With a cost-of-living index at 93.2, the purchasing power for technicians in this area may be better than the nominal salary figures suggest, allowing for a relatively balanced lifestyle. Among employers, outpatient dialysis chains such as Fresenius, DaVita, and US Renal Care dominate the field, collectively controlling nearly 90% of the market. These companies often utilize structured pay scales, further contributing to the disparity in salaries, particularly where shift differentials and special roles like home dialysis training can significantly influence pay. For those in the local market, strategies to maximize earning potential include seeking evening shifts, exploring lead or charge positions, and pursuing certifications from recognized bodies like NNCC, BONENT, or NNCO, which can also provide access to higher-paying roles in training and mentorship.
